Step 1: Prepare the Soil 1. Fill the containers or seed trays with seed starting mix or potting soil. 2. Moisten the soil with water. Step 2: Sow the Seeds 1. Read the seed package for specific sowing instructions, as some herbs have unique requirements. 2. Sow the seeds about 1/8 inch deep and 1-2 inches apart. 3. Cover the seeds with a thin layer of soil. Step 3: Provide Warmth and Light 1. Place the containers or seed trays in a warm location, such as a sunny windowsill or under grow lights. 2. Maintain a consistent temperature between 65°F to 75°F (18°C to 24°C). Step 4: Water and Maintain Humidity 1. Water the soil gently but thoroughly. 2. Maintain a humid environment by covering the containers or seed trays with a clear plastic bag or a cloche. Step 5: Fertilize (Optional) 1. Once the seedlings have 2-3 sets of leaves, you can start fertilizing them with a balanced, water-soluble fertilizer. Step 6: Transplant 1. Once the seedlings have 4-6 sets of leaves, transplant them into individual pots or into a larger container. 2. Harden off the seedlings by gradually exposing them to outdoor conditions over the course of 7-10 days. Step 7: Prune and Harvest 1. Prune the herbs regularly to encourage bushy growth and prevent them from flowering. 2. Harvest the herbs when they are at their peak flavor and aroma.
